Description: 三维重构的思路很简单,用OpenGL中纹理贴图功能,将平面图像中的三角形逐个贴到计算出的三维坐标上去就可以了。为了便于观察3D效果,我还设计了交互功能:用方向键可以上下左右旋转重构的模型,用鼠标滚轮可以放大或缩小。用gluLookAt函数可以实现视点旋转的功能。三维重构的代码实现在glFuncs.cpp中。(Three-dimensional reconstruction of the idea is very simple, with OpenGL texture mapping function, the plane image of the triangle one by one to the calculated three-dimensional coordinates up on it. In order to facilitate the observation of 3D effects, I also designed the interactive function: the arrow keys can be rotated up and down around the reconstructed model, with the mouse wheel can zoom in or out. Use gluLookAt function to achieve the function of point rotation. The three-dimensional reconstructed code is implemented in glFuncs.cpp.) Platform: |

Description: matlab程序。利用二维图像生成3d形状,有原始代码,有测试数据。(We investigate the problem of estimating the 3D shape of an object, given a set of 2D landmarks in a single image.To alleviate the reconstruction ambiguity, a widely-used approach is to confine the unknown 3D shape within a shape space built upon existing shapes. While this approach has proven to be successful in various applications, a challenging issue remains, i.e., the joint estimation of shape parameters and camera-pose parameters requires to solve a nonconvex
optimization problem. The existing methods often adopt an alternating minimization scheme to locally update the parameters, and consequently the solution is sensitive
to initialization. In this paper, we propose a convex formulation to address this problem and develop an efficient algorithm to solve the proposed convex program. We demonstrate the exact recovery property of the proposed method, its merits compared to alternative methods, and the applicability in human pose and car shape estimation.) Platform: |
